What this index covers
This index maps how India’s domestic IP statutes interface with the international treaty framework India has joined or must account for: filing-priority mechanisms (Paris Convention, PCT receiving-office and international-search procedure, foreign-filing licence under Patents Act Section 39), classification systems examiners use (Nice, Vienna, Locarno, International Patent Classification), deposit and registration systems (Budapest Treaty biological-material deposits, Madrid Protocol trademarks, Hague System designs), copyright/neighbouring-rights treaties (Berne Convention, WIPO Copyright Treaty, WIPO Performances and Phonograms Treaty), TRIPS minimum standards and the Doha Declaration on public health, and GI/biodiversity interfaces (Lisbon/Geneva GI systems, the Convention on Biological Diversity and Nagoya Protocol).
